Os pacotes de cliente-servidor Apache Wink são feitos para serem usados juntos.
O pacote do lado do servidor é basicamente uma implementação dos JAX-RS 1.1 de especificação, um poderoso API Java para trabalhar com RESTful Web Services.
Este é o lugar onde a maioria de sua aplicação terá de ser desenvolvido, enquanto o pacote do cliente é um módulo simples para consumir as informações do servidor.
Os blocos de construção básicos incluídos com Wink incluem suporte para trabalhar com recursos, fornecedores, ativos, URIs, anotações, métodos HTTP, e os parâmetros de consulta URL.
Além disso, para o pacote do cliente há apoio para as aulas restclient, ClientConfig e EntityType, junto com Resource, ClientHandler, InputStreamAdapter, OutputStreamAdapter, ClientRequest e interfaces de ClientResponse.
O que é novo em nesta versão:
- Bugs:
- GET métodos falham em atender as solicitações sem Content-Type se a classe / interface temConsumes
- Adicionar suporte autenticação de proxy para o restclient
- Corrigir mensagem de erro obscura durante a geração Doc Serviço
- resoluçãoPathParam da Resource Locator não é correto.
- GenericsUtils.isAssignable () não consegue lidar com tipos primitivos
- AdminServlet não processa QueryParams corretamente
- HttpHeadersImpl.getCookies () somente sempre retorna o primeiro biscoito no cabeçalho do biscoito
- Os testes JSON4J estão falhando devido a não ser capaz de encontrar recursos de teste
- blocos JAXBXmlProvider implementação JAXB de análise com êxito XML quando nenhum tipo de concreto pode ser encontrado.
- org.apache.wink.test.mock.MockHttpServletRequestWrapper não manipula getContentType () e métodos de parâmetros relacionados
- Melhorias:
- feijão Suporte web / (J) CDI / JSR-299
- Alguns plugins versões ausentes
- Upgrade para slf4j 1.6.0
- Debug - & # x3e; Reforma registro de rastreamento
- melhoria de Manutenção; exteriorizar cordas, confirmar a formatação
- Faça Jackson o provedor JSON padrão para Wink
- melhoria de Manutenção, informações de saída no momento do registro de candidatura, erros
- Permitir arquivo de configuração para SSL
- Anotações herdados por uma classe de recurso deve determinar o tipo de parâmetro na subclasse, não a superclasse
- Melhorar a tolerância de tipos de mídia malformados
- Simplifique a adição de manipuladores de solicitação / resposta li>
- Permitir AtomCommonAttributes # otherAttributes e AtomCommonAttributesSimpleContent # otherAttributes ser preguiçoso inicializado.
- New Feature:
- apoio WADL
- modelo Wink JSON
- XmlJavaTypeAdapter Apoio eXmlElement no método params
- Adicionar suporte ao gerenciamento de ciclo de vida JSR250
- módulo AsyncHttpClient
- Adicionar um provedor piscadela para o Google Protocol Tampão
- Adicionar um provedor piscadela para Apache Thrift
Comentários não encontrado